Независимая разработка игр - Советы

Картинки по запросу независимая разработка игрСоветы независимому разработчику игр

Став независимым разработчиком каждый нашёл, что может внести инновацию в индустрию игр.

Многие независимые разработчики работали в игрострое до того как стать независимыми.

Чтобы развивать игростудию надо хотеть строить свои игры.

Нужно желание изучить бизнес игростроя, которое происходит из желания решать проблемы и изучать новые идеи.

Пробуй работать над лучшими вещами всё время - это реальный вызов и всегда неизвестно что получишь. Ты никогда не знаешь какая вещь лучше, но используй оценку и опыт, чтобы принимать хорошие решения.

Важно выйти из зоны комфорта.

Картинки по запросу indie game studioСоздание игростудии - ощущается как выграть в лотерею и ехать в объезд, чтобы избежать пробок.



Мы хотим создавать что-то (рассказывать истории, строить системы или создавать красивые миры)

Используйте опыт и талант как рычаг

Постоянство - разделяет успешных и неуспешных

Одна реально хорошая идея и сотрудничество с другими для воплощения её.

Обязательно заканчивайте работу надо начатой задумкой, доводите дело до конца. Определите для себя минимальный функционал игры или приложения - это позволит конкретизировать задачу и сократит объём работы до выпуска первой версии.

Улучшать можно бесконечно, но оставьте "плюшки" для следующих выпусков, иначе можно погрязнуть в таком процессе и, в конечном счёте, потерять интерес

Стремитесь сделать качественный продукт.

Это касается всех элементов игры: архитектуры проекта, кода, текстур, звуков и музыки. Для этого ищите профессиональные ответы на возникшие перед вами вопросы, читайте профильную литературу.

"Не пытайтесь быть профессионалом.

Создание чего-то личного - противоположно тому, что создают студии" Джон Блоу

Решиться довести игру до конца.

Заканчивать игры - навык, который стоит развить.

Начинайте с малого, тренируйтесь проходить путь от идеи до релиза.

Если бросить посередине пути, то всё было зря и ничего не достиг.

Когда возможно, используйте снова готовые элементы, чем создавать новое. Очень важно хорошо использовать элементы игры, которые есть.
И быть осторожнее при добавлении слишком большого количества элементов в свою игру.

Игра - это серия интересных выборов.



Картинки по запросу videogameУбедившись, что твои механики уникальны и мало пересекаются по функциям, то обеспечите интересными возможностями игрока и даст ему причину вернуться.

Спросить о цели каждого элемента игры. Если найдёшь две пересекающиеся механики - подумай о том, чтобы удалить или редизайнить в сторону уникальности.

Не бойтесь сделать шаг назад и редизайнить или переработать.

Неважно, какую игру вы разрабатываете, здесь нет обязательных элементов и свойств.

Изучая свою игру с разных сторон и пытаясь по разному сделать однотипные механики - можно сделать более интересную игру.

Что это свойство скрывает?
Есть ли лучшая механика в тени этой механики.

Добавлять и удалять механики чтобы посмотреть на контраст

Сфокусироваться на контенте

Не позволяйте вторичным вещам отвлекать вас от важных

Спрашивайте: "Добавит ли свойство продаж или удовольствия игрокам?"

Не изобретайте колесо. Никогда не тратьте много времени, пытаясь сделать с нуля, когда вы легко можете использовать существующий инструмент.

Независимый разработчик не должен тратить больше полугода на проект.

Самое важное - создать как можно больше игр в короткое время, чтобы получить много опыта. Это поможет определить в чём вы хороши, а в чём плохи.

Если вложить слишком много сил в проект, это помешает двигаться дальше и пробовать другие вещи.
Дополнительное время добавит давления на успех и сделает потенциальную неудачу хуже

Ограничивая время на проект вы предотвращаете его разрастание больше чем задумано.

Это неприятно - заканчивать рано, но ещё хуже тратить 2-3 года на проект, который ожидаешь, что займёт 2-3 месяца.

Иногда нужно просто отпустить проект.
Картинки по запросу отпустить




Как привлечь разных типов игроков
 
Картинки по запросу геймеры посиделкиПодумай о трёх типах игроков: с опытом, со временем и с деньгами.
Для привлечения игроков с опытом надо создать хорошую систему боя. Она может привлекать большое количество игроков.

Для привлечения игроков со свободным временем нужно делать случайных врагов, чтобы гринд не надоедал, когда они переигрывают уровень 3-4 раза.

Для игроков с деньгами - чтобы увидеть весь контент, можно купить любую вещь в игре, и улучшиться до максимального уровня меньше чем за $50.




Как разрабатывать по 2 часа в день и сделать игру
 
Картинки по запросу разработкаЕсли использовать 2х часовые забеги каждый день, то чтобы поддерживать мотивацию высокой и получать радость от работы над своими играми надо следовать правилу:
 "Надо выбирать только те свойства, которые можно сделать в удовлетворительные 2х часовые отрезки. В конце каждой сессии надо иметь полностью рабочую, компилирующуюся версию игры и ощущать, как будто ты достиг чего-то полезного"

Игры под такие короткие сроки и разорванный график должны быть меньше в масштабе и проще.

Цель - создать игру интересную и все свойства, которые не помогают достичь этого или трудны в реализации надо резать.

Это означает - без сети, без сторонних SDK, без монолитных кусков новой технологии (может один кусок на один проект)

Работая частично нужно набирать ценный опыт, кодовую базу, каталог действующих приложений и взаимоотношения с платформодержателями.
После этого можно идти путём полностью независимого разработчика.

Комментарии

Популярные сообщения